Set in Haynesville, Louisiana, Haynesville Elementary School is an intimate elementary school, run under Claiborne Parish. It teaches 304 students across grades pre-K through 5. By comparison, Louisiana's public schools average about 453 students each, so Haynesville Elementary School sits 33% leaner than that benchmark.
Within Claiborne Parish, which oversees 6 schools and 1,616 students, Haynesville Elementary School is one campus in the system.
On demographics, Haynesville Elementary School shows that Black students make up the majority at 61%. The remainder consists of 36% White. That is considerably more Black than the county at large, where the share is closer to 50%.
Looking at school resources, The school lists 21 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 14.6:1. The state averages about 14.0:1, putting this campus right in line with peers. About 84%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al.
After controlling for student poverty, Haynesville Elementary School s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 24.1%; this one delivers 26.3%.
In the area at large, Claiborne Parish reports that median household income runs about $32,831, 11%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 22%. Across Claiborne Parish's 6 public schools (combined enrollment of about 1,616 students), Haynesville Elementary School is one campus in the mix.
Nearest neighbor: Haynesville Jr./Sr. High School, around 0.4 miles off. Within ten miles, there are 2 other public schools, a sparser pattern than typical urban areas. Among the 7 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Haynesville Elementary School ranks 3rd on composite proficiency, higher than the local average of 25.6%.
The school occupies a rural site.
Over the past 7-year window. Haynesville Elementary School's enrollment has ticked up 19% since 2018, when it stood at 256 (now 304). The Black share of enrollment ticked up from 55% to 61% over that span. The student-to-teacher ratio tightened from 21.3:1 in 2018 to 14.6:1 today.
